Welcome to Three Corner Farm, a beautifully restored circa-1905 farmhouse nestled on 3.35 picturesque acres in Western Charles County. Just an easy commute to Washington, DC and Alexandria, this one-of-a-kind property offers the perfect blend of historic charm, smart and sophisticated updates, and a homestead lifestyle built with thoughtfulness and intentionality.

From the moment you arrive, the sweeping willow tree, inviting front porch, and tranquil setting graciously welcome you to make yourself at home. Inside, the thoughtfully renovated farmhouse is designed for both everyday living and effortless entertaining. The heart of the home is a stunning farmhouse kitchen with soapstone countertops and dining area with custom window seating that creates the perfect gathering space for quality time with your loved ones and hospitality.

French doors open from the family room to a spacious rear deck, seamlessly connecting indoor and outdoor living where you can enjoy summer BBQ's, outdoor movies, and fire pits on cool nights. A cozy reading room with built-in floor to ceiling bookshelves in the library room flows into a bright sunroom overlooking the herb garden—ideal as a home office, playroom, or creative retreat.

Outside, the homestead lifestyle calls you. Wander through the fenced culinary herb garden, pick fresh fruit from established orchards and berry plantings, harvest figs from the mature fig grove, or relax beside the wildlife pond under the willow tree. A charming chicken coop sits close to the home, crafted from reclaimed wood during the home's restoration, can even come with its resident hens for fresh eggs. Standing watch over it all is a magnificent White Oak with a tire swing, believed to be among the oldest in Maryland, a breathtaking centerpiece and living piece of history.

A detached three-car garage/woodworking shop, run-in shed, and expansive grounds offer endless possibilities for gardening, hobby farming, recreation, and entertaining.

Whether you're hosting friends under the stars, sharing farm-fresh meals, or simply enjoying the beauty and privacy of the countryside, Three Corner Farm offers a rare opportunity to embrace a slower, more intentional way of life.

What's growing at Three Corner Farm? The fig grove has 3 dozen fig trees from Greece. The kitchen garden has a variety of fresh herbs (rosemary, basil cilantro, parsley, sage, thyme, tarragon) and fruit (native kiwi, peaches, blueberries, blackberry, raspberry, cherries) available throughout the year. There are also flowers including phlox, coneflower, vervain, milkweed, coreopsis, blazing star, guara, honeysuckle, zinnia, and more. There are also peach trees, a variety of wild berries, a concord grape vine, and sunchokes.
